Projects of the position:

The PIE (Product Information Experience) team builds and operates a distributed, event-driven set of services responsible for processing, normalizing, and delivering product data from multiple upstream systems to the Shopping Platform. The team owns multiple loosely coupled microservices that communicate through asynchronous event streams and synchronous APIs to support scalable, reliable, near-real-time data propagation.
